Bristol solicitor, Alistair Duncan, is called in by insurers, to protect their interests, after a foreman is found dead, on a building site, at Shepton Mallet. Duncan's investigations throw doubt on the official theory that the dead man was accidently electrocuted. Why had witnesses lied at the inquest? What was the guilty secret of the beautiful and seductive young widow, June Hillyer, a girl with tastes beyond her means? And what claims could she make for damages? Why, too, was Dwight Riley the victim of brutal intimidation? As the sinister nature of the investigations unfold, the story rushes to a menacing climax when some unexpected answers are revealed. Enquiry agent, Charlie Wilkinson, reappears as does Lucy, Duncan's saucy and taunting secretary in this, the third, story of the solicitor who, in determined search for the truth, defies authority and danger alike.
